Trying to avoid Keyword Cannibalization
-
I have a navigation menu at the top of my page with drop down menus that lead to different pages of my web site. Very typical navigation.
If I have a page that is optimized for a particular keyword, lets say "Awesome Blue Widgets", do I want to remove that link from the navigation menu on the page awesome-blue-widgets.htm since the link uses the keyword phrase "Awesome Blue Widgets'?
-
No, I would not recommend that. Keyword cannibalization becomes an issue when you have multiple pages on your site that target or focus on the same exact keyword phrase which results in pages competing with each other.
